    I was just thinking, there have been songs either about or featuring cars such as Corvettes and XK-E Jaguars, GTOs, Chevys, Mustangs, T-Birds, Hot Rod Lincolns, Nash Ramblers, and even a Super Stock Dodge. But how many songs actually feature a station wagon? Woody wagons certainly get mentioned frequently in songs by the Beach Boys and Jan and Dean. Songs such as Little Surfer Girl by the Beach Boys is a good example. But what about your more common more modern all-steel station wagon? There are only two songs I can think of that even mention a wagon thats not a woody. Theres the 1973 top 10 hit by Loudoun Wainright III. Its a catchy little tune called, "Dead Skunk in the Middle of the Road", and it contains the lyrics, " ...he didn't see the station wagon car, the skunk got squashed and there you are, you got your dead skunk in the middle of the road...". The only other song I could think of, I don't really know. I heard it a couple times maybe 10 years ago on some country music station. I don't know who sang it or what the title was, but I'll never forget the lyrics, "cruisin in my station wagon tryin to keep the tail pipe from draggin". Anyone remember that song? And does anyone remember any other station wagon songs that portray wagons in a more positive light? It seems that station wagons don't get no respect from song writers unless they're woodys.
